Minnesota Wild & Philadelphia Flyers Linked to Pre-Deadline Trade

The NHL's trade market is currently on a holiday roster freeze, but once the Christmas break is over, keep an eye on the Minnesota Wild and Philadelphia Flyers. The two teams have been linked multiple times to a trade together this season, and most recently from Anthony Di Marco of Daily Faceoff .  Di Marco sees the Wild having interest in Flyers injured forward Tyson Foerster, who is currently recovering from surgery and is expected to be out for the rest of the season. Phillies agree to deal with RHP Zach Pop

The Phillies announced today that they have agreed to a deal with right-handed pitcher Zach Pop. Pop, 29, is a five-year MLB veteran who spent 2025 with the Mariners, Mets, and Cubs but only appeared in five MLB games. EOTP’s Montreal Canadiens Stars of the Week

The Habs went 2-1-1 during the third week of December, and now sit second in the Atlantic Division with a record of 19-12-5. Montreal’s week got off to a rocky start after Sunday’s commanding win over the Edmonton Oilers, faltering against the Philadelphia Flyers. After Alexandre Texier opened the scoring just a minute into the game, the Habs went on to allow four straight and lose 4-1, with Jacob Fowler ending up placing the dagger himself after a turnover behind the net. Today In NHL History - Laviolette Shoves Steve Ott

On December 21st in 2011, Philadelphia Flyers head coach Peter Laviolette shoved Dallas Stars forward Steve Ott aside upon being blocked from exiting the benches through the tunnel after the first period of play at the American Airlines Center. Afterwards, Ott outed Laviolette's actions as arrogant, adding "It's disrespect of our building, just let our team off, it's not that big of a deal."
